Understanding the Importance of Silage Preservation
Silage is fermented, high-moisture stored fodder that livestock rely on, particularly during dry or off-season periods. Maintaining its nutritional value and preventing spoilage is essential for farm productivity and animal health. However, silage is vulnerable to oxygen and water ingress, both of which can degrade feed quality by promoting mould growth and nutrient loss.
Traditional silage covers often fall short in providing the necessary protection against environmental elements, especially rain and humidity, which are prevalent in many Australian regions.
What Are Waterproof Silage Covers?
Waterproof silage covers are specially designed protective films or sheets made from durable materials such as polyethylene, treated to resist water penetration while allowing minimal oxygen permeability. Their primary function is to create an airtight and watertight seal over silage piles or bunkers, preserving the integrity of the feed underneath.
In contrast to conventional covers, these innovative products incorporate advanced technology to withstand harsh weather conditions, resist tearing, and offer long-lasting protection. Their development marks a significant step forward in silage management strategies.
Key Benefits of Waterproof Silage Covers in Australian Farming
Superior Moisture Protection
Australia’s climate varies widely — from wet coastal areas to arid inland regions — but the risk of unexpected rainfall or morning dew is ever-present. Waterproof silage covers act as an impermeable barrier, preventing water from saturating the silage. It is vital because excess moisture can lead to:
- Increased spoilage due to aerobic bacterial activity
- Loss of dry matter and nutrients
- Reduced feed quality and palatability
By keeping moisture out, these covers help maintain the silage’s optimum fermentation environment, resulting in better feed preservation.

Innovations Driving the Evolution of Waterproof Silage Covers
Advanced Materials and Coatings
Modern waterproof silage covers are not just simple plastic sheets. They feature multilayer construction and UV-resistant coatings, which enhance durability and lifespan. Some covers incorporate antimicrobial treatments that prevent mould and fungal growth on the cover’s surface, providing an additional layer of protection.
Improved Breathability and Gas Exchange
A common challenge with silage covers is striking a balance between airtightness and the need for gas exchange during the fermentation process. Recent innovations include semi-permeable membranes that allow carbon dioxide to escape while blocking oxygen and water. It optimises fermentation conditions, resulting in higher quality silage.
Customised Sizes and Thicknesses
Australian farmers face diverse operational needs based on the scale and type of silage storage — from bunkers and pits to stacks and bags. Waterproof silage covers are now available in a range of sizes, thicknesses, and strengths, allowing farmers to select products tailored to their specific requirements.
Integration with Silage Management Systems
Some waterproof silage covers are designed to work seamlessly with monitoring technologies, such as sensors that track temperature and moisture levels under the cover. This integration enables proactive management, helping farmers intervene early if conditions become suboptimal.

Mobility scooters are motorised devices designed to assist individuals with mobility challenges. They come in various models, including portable, mid-size, and heavy-duty options, each tailored to specific needs and lifestyles. In South Australia, mobility scooters that do not exceed 10 km/h and are used by individuals with mobility impairments are classified as pedestrians under the Australian Road Rules.
